AB 701
Advanced Animal Behavior
Husson University · UGRD · Fall 2026
1 section
Catalog description
In this course, students study the biology of animal behavior across a variety of species. Students follow a data-driven approach to examine the role of anatomy and physiology, genetics, and evolution in animal behavior, with a focus on a species or a behavior of their choice.
